Went to John Mitchell. He looked a tank a hoses. It was p*ssing out in front of him as we spoke through the overflow hose. I told him what had happended. He said not a tank, more than likely the cap. He changed cap , turned the switch on above tank that clears any air blockages. Let it idle for 15 mins and all seemed ok. I drove home and not a drop has come out so all looks good.

His diagnosis was the cap was faulty causing air blocks and over flow to p*ss out . Showed me how to clear air blocks . Change cap for 01 model (15 quid) spoke to me for 30 mins about Porsches then I went. All in all cost me 15 quid . Seems fine now. :-)
